SOLVAY GROUP
2(nd) QUARTER BUSINESS REVIEW
Excellent operating result in the 2(nd) quarter of 2011:
REBITDA (EUR 304 million) up by 12% compared to the 2(nd) quarter of 2010
* Increase in sales volume (+4%) reflecting very sustained overall global
activity
* Higher sales prices (+11%) compensating for rise in energy costs
* Operating margin - REBITDA on sales - stable at 18%
* Net result of EUR 111 million, greatly improved from last year
* Launch of a friendly cash offer for Rhodia on June 15, 2011
Quote of the CEO
The 2(nd) quarter of 2011 has been excellent for Solvay with demand supporting
volume growth of 4% while we achieved prices 11% ahead of the same period last
year. Taken together this led to REBITDA and REBIT from continuing operations up
by 12% and 27% respectively. We continue to trade in line with our expectations.
Outlook
The Solvay Group is attentive to the macro-economic developments and the
evolution of the energy and ethylene costs. In the context of the current
business climate and based on its strategy of sustainable and profitable growth,
Solvay expects to improve its annual operating result, both in Chemical and
Plastic activities in 2011.
